Brotliは、データを圧縮することでコンピューターファイルのサイズを縮小する技術です。サイトで使用されるHTML、CSS、JavaScriptファイルのようなテキストベースのファイルに最適です。SVG画像ファイルや、WOFFやWOFF2などのテキストベースのフォントもBrotliで圧縮できます。
一般的なGzip圧縮に代わるもので、ファイルが小さくなるなど、いくつかの利点があります。ファイルが小さくなるとダウンロードが速くなり、WordPressサイトのパフォーマンスが向上します。
ほとんどの主要ウェブブラウザはBrotli圧縮をサポートしています。圧縮されたファイルはダウンロード後に解凍され、ブラウザーに表示される必要があるため、これは不可欠です。
ブロートリー・コンプレッションの仕組み
Brotli圧縮は、HTML、CSS、JavaScriptなどのテキストベースのファイルのサイズを縮小するために使用される方法です。
繰り返されるテキスト・フレーズを識別し、より短い参照に置き換えることで、ファイル・サイズ全体を縮小します。これを実現するために、一般的に使用される語句の標準辞書と、ファイルを分析しながらビルトインされる動的辞書が使用されます。
Brotli圧縮を使用すると、サイトのファイルを小さくすることができます。これは、すべての一般的なウェブブラウザ、サーバーソフトウェア、および最高のWordPressホスティングサービスでサポートされています。
小さなファイルは、誰かがあなたのサイトにアクセスしたときに、より迅速にダウンロードすることができ、より速く読み込むことができます。ウェブブラウザはダウンロードされたファイルを自動的に解凍して表示します。
Brotli圧縮はWordPressサイトをどのように高速化しますか?
Brotli圧縮は、サイトの見た目や動作を変えることなく、読み込みを15~20%高速化します。
Google PageSpeed Insightsのようなサイトスピードテストツールは、しばしばウェブサイトのパフォーマンスを向上させるためにテキスト圧縮を有効化することをお勧めします。次のスクリーンショットでは、BrotliまたはGzip圧縮を有効にすると、Webページが3.15秒速く読み込まれると推定している.
より高速なサイトはユーザー体験を向上させ、ビジネスの売上とコンバージョンを増やすことができます。
読み込み時間の短縮は、検索エンジンのランキング要因にもなります。つまり、サイトでBrotli圧縮を有効化することで、SEOも向上します。
Brotli圧縮はテキストファイルのためのもので、画像や動画のためのものではありません。しかし、WordPressサイトで画像をウェブ用に最適化するために使用できるテクニックは他にもあります。
一方、Brotliを使えば、XMLベースのため、SVGベクター画像ファイルを50~80%圧縮できる。
WordPressキャッシュプラグインでBrotli圧縮を有効化する方法
Brotli圧縮を有効化するには、それをサポートするWordPressキャッシュプラグインをインストールします。これらのプラグインの中には、初期設定でBrotliが有効になっているものもあれば、プラグインの設定で有効化する必要があるものもあります。
例えば、Cloudflareは初期設定でBrotli圧縮を有効化し、15-20%の速度向上を実現しています。この設定はプラグインを有効化したときにオンになります。
Brotli圧縮が有効化されていることを確認する方法
多くのホスティングサービスプロバイダーは、自動的にBrotliまたはGzip圧縮を有効化します。初期設定でBrotli圧縮を有効化する会社には、SiteGround、WP Engine、Hostinger、GreenGeeksなどがあります。
オンラインのGzipおよびBrotli圧縮チェッカーツールを使って、サイトの圧縮が有効化されているかどうかをテストできます。ツールのサイトにアクセスし、サイトのURLを入力するだけです。有効化されていれば「GZIP Is Enabled」というメッセージが表示されます。
うまくいかない場合は、以前ご紹介したようなキャッシュプラグインをインストールしてGzipを有効化し、再度サイトをテストしてください。
Brotli圧縮とGzip圧縮の違いは?
Gzip圧縮は長い間使われてきた。1992年にリリースされたフリーでオープンソースの圧縮プログラムで、業界標準となり、最高のキャッシュプラグインやCDNによってサポートされています。
Brotliデータ圧縮アルゴリズムはより新しく、2013年から2016年にかけてGoogleによって開発された。Gzipよりも効果的に繰り返しパターンを特定し置き換える、より現代的で複雑な技術を使用している。
つまり、BrotliはGzipよりも速く、効果的にファイルを圧縮できるのです。Gzipに比べて15-20%の圧縮率、5-10%のページ読み込み時間の短縮が期待できます。
その結果、Brotliの採用は、主要なCDNやキャッシュプラグインの間で急速に拡大しました。
Brotli圧縮をサポートするプラグインを使用している場合、有効化することでサイトのパフォーマンスが向上し、ユーザーエクスペリエンスとSEOが改善されます。
WPBeginnerサイトではBrotli圧縮を使用しています。
WordPressのBrotli圧縮について、この投稿がお役に立てば幸いです。また、WordPressの便利なヒントやトリック、アイデアに関する関連投稿については、以下の「Additional Reading」リストをご覧ください。
If you liked this article, then please subscribe to our YouTube Channel for WordPress video tutorials. You can also find us on Twitter and Facebook.